A survey of readers of Alpine Quarterly, a magazine devoted to extreme mountaineering, found that 85% of respondents rated a new ultralight tent favorably. The tent manufacturer concludes that the tent will be popular with the general camping public.

The manufacturer's conclusion is most vulnerable to the criticism that it:

  1. Fails to consider that ultralight tents in general tend to be considerably more expensive than standard camping tents on the market.
  2. Draws a conclusion about ordinary campers from a small sample of enthusiasts whose gear priorities differ sharply from theirs.
  3. Assumes that every single reader who responded to the survey actually owns and has personally used the ultralight tent in question.
  4. Neglects to report what percentage of Alpine Quarterly's total readership chose to respond to the survey in the first place.
  5. Overlooks the fact that reader surveys of this kind are generally an unreliable method for gauging any product's quality.
